Ranking of Wyoming Counties By Hispanic or Latino Population in 2011

Updated on June 18, 2025.

Based on the US Census Vintage data estimates, in 2011, among all Wyoming counties, Laramie County had the highest number of people who identified their ethnicity as Hispanic or Latino (12.33K), followed by Sweetwater County (6.85K), and Natrona County (5.53K).

Ranking of Wyoming Counties By Hispanic or Latino Population in 2011
0 of 0
Rank County Hispanic or Latino Population
1 Laramie County 12325
2 Sweetwater County 6847
3 Natrona County 5534
4 Campbell County 3579
5 Albany County 3265
6 Teton County 3175
7 Carbon County 2695
8 Fremont County 2435
9 Uinta County 1795
10 Park County 1407
11 Goshen County 1385
12 Washakie County 1158
13 Sheridan County 1119
14 Big Horn County 1012
15 Converse County 913
16 Lincoln County 724
17 Sublette County 709
18 Platte County 609
19 Johnson County 318
20 Weston County 244
21 Crook County 168
22 Hot Springs County 119
23 Niobrara County 64
